The West Coast Krush 05 Girls team closed out Winter League this past Sunday with a 4-0 victory over San Bruno Lowen Thunder.

 

After a scoreless first half, Kayla Robinson broke the deadlock when she scored Krush’s first goal of the game, off a free kick from Paige McLean. Two minutes later, Hailey Rodear chipped the ball up to Kira Korsak who shot the ball past San Bruno’s keeper, upping the score to 2-0. With seven minutes remaining in the game, Korsak sent a free kick from the right side into the goalie box that was deflected by San Bruno but Lauren Stoneberger intercepted the deflection and sent the ball high in the corner of the net, giving Krush a 3-0 lead. Three minutes later Krush scored its fourth, and final goal of the game Carly’s Singleton’s hit the corner kick that just went over the goalie’s outstretched hands and bounced into the goal. Final score 4-0, with goal keeper Cassidy Pearson earning the shutout.
